Lyntris Inc., a defense technology company, has priced its initial public offering (IPO) at $17.50 per share, below the previously announced range of $19 to $22 per share. The company is offering 24 million shares, with 4,878,049 shares being sold by Lyntris and 19,121,951 shares offered by certain selling stockholders. The underwriters have also been granted a 30-day option to purchase up to an additional 3.6 million shares to cover over-allotments.

Lyntris, which provides "sense-to-act" connectivity solutions for military applications, will list on the New York Stock Exchange under the ticker symbol "LYNX". The offering is being managed by lead book-running managers Evercore ISI, Citigroup, and Guggenheim Securities, with BofA Securities serving as a joint book-running manager.

The IPO is part of a broader trend of defense technology firms seeking public market funding amid heightened investor interest in the sector. The company’s valuation is expected to reach up to $2.53 billion based on the IPO price and total shares offered.
